The Mercer University School of Medicine (MUSM) Department of Psychiatry and Behavioral Sciences seeks new faculty to join our Master of Family Therapy (MFT) Program on the Macon campus. This is a 12-month, non-tenure track position on the Medical Educator track.
Responsibilities
-
to teach MFT courses.
-
to serve as a clinical supervisor to MFT students.
-
to contribute to the day to day functioning of the Mercer Family Therapy Center.
-
to contribute to governance of the Mercer MFT program by participating in regular faculty meetings, student admissions decisions, curriculum reviews, clinical evaluations of students, and/or special committees as needed (i.e., faculty/staff hiring interviews).
-
to engage in one or more of the four types of scholarship: (A) investigative research (including quantitative, qualitative, or mixed methods and program evaluation), (B) interdisciplinary integration, (C) application of theory/research/practice feedback loop, and/or (D) transformation of teaching practices.
-
to serve as a student-centered academic and professional development advisor and mentor to students.
-
to serve as a role model for professional development through his or her active participation in MFT and/or interdisciplinary professional organizations.
-
to serve as a role-model for interdisciplinary collaborative partnerships through service to the university and community.
Qualifications
Candidates must:
-
be a graduate of a doctoral program in marriage and family therapy or a closely related field (e.g., Counseling, Social Work, Psychology)
-
be an AAMFT Approved Supervisor or eligible
The ideal candidate will:
-
be licensed or license eligible in the state of Georgia as a marriage and family therapist
-
have clinical experience with a variety of client populations
-
have experience with MFT education
-
be able to contribute to program operations and governance both independently and as a collaborative team member
